How to prepare for this question:
  • Review the latest research and best practices in consultation-liaison psychiatry to demonstrate your up-to-date knowledge in the field.
  • Prepare specific examples of your experience in educating and training medical students in psychiatry, highlighting your achievements and impact on their learning.
  • Reflect on your communication and interpersonal skills, and think of specific scenarios where you effectively consulted with medical teams and interacted with patients.
  • Consider your experiences collaborating with other healthcare professionals and providing patient-centered care, and be prepared to discuss the outcomes of these collaborations.
  • Highlight your commitment to continuous professional development by mentioning any additional certifications, conferences, workshops, or publications in psychiatry.
What are interviewers evaluating with this question?
  • Communication skills
  • Psychiatric knowledge
  • Teaching and mentoring abilities
  • Collaboration skills
  • Professional development
